Is Riverdale Park Safe?

Yes — this neighborhood is very safe. Riverdale Park in Modesto, CA has a safety grade of A. The overall crime index is 68, which is 32% below the national average of 100.

Compared to the Modesto average (crime index 127), Riverdale Park is 59% lower in overall crime. This neighborhood is significantly safer than Modesto as a whole, making it an attractive option for safety-conscious residents.

Looking at specific crime types, robbery is the most elevated concern (index: 124, 24% above average), while assault is the lowest risk (index: 44).
